Measuring Minds

Discover the intriguing history of intelligence testing in Measuring Minds by Leila Zenderland, published by Cambridge University Press in 2001. This comprehensive volume spans 478 pages and delves into the life of Henry Herbert Goddard, America’s pioneering intelligence tester. Zenderland meticulously traces how Goddard sought to integrate this French innovation into the fabric of American society, revealing the complexities and controversies surrounding psychological assessment.

With a focus on the evolution of intelligence testing from the 1500s onwards, this book is an essential read for anyone interested in the history of psychology, the development of testing and measurement, and the societal implications of intelligence assessments in the United States.
